Vincent Julien Sasso (born 16 February 1991) is a French footballer who plays for English club Sheffield Wednesday on loan from S.C. Braga as a fullback or a central defender.

Club career

Sasso was born in Saint-Cloud, Paris. On 18 June 2008 he signed his first professional contract with FC Nantes, agreeing to a three-year deal. He made his professional debut on 31 July 2010 in a 2–4 penalty shootout away loss against US Boulogne for the season's Coupe de la Ligue,[1] and went on to spend two years with the first team in Ligue 1, contributing with 20 games to a ninth-place in 2011–12.

In the 2012 summer, Sasso joined S.C. Beira-Mar in Portugal for three years.[2] He scored his first goal for the Aveiro club on 6 October, putting the visitors ahead in an eventual 1–2 defeat at S.L. Benfica;[3] his team would eventually suffer relegation, but he had already left in late January 2013 to fellow league side S.C. Braga, penning a contract until June 2017.[4]
